how much body water does ICF make up?

Two thirds of all water in the body

2
New cards

How much of the body is made up of ECF?

One third of all water in the body

3
New cards

How much of total body weight is made up of water?

60-80%

What is the daily maintenance requirements for a dog?

40-60ml/Kg body weight/24 hours (50ml)

13
New cards

What is the daily maintenance requirements for a cat?

60ml/kg body weight/24 hours

14
New cards

What is the daily maintenance requirements for a kitten?

150ml/kg/body weight /24 hours

15
New cards

What is different for daily maintenance requirements if a patient is Pyrexic?

Need to add extra 3ml/kg body weight/ degree above normal /24 hours
